Overview
💡This section is only available to the Manager profile💡
The Mock Crisis Challenge section allows organizations to test and improve their crisis management readiness by simulating real-world incidents. It helps identify gaps in procedures and ensures teams are prepared to respond effectively.
Within this section, users can document:
- Location – The site where the mock crisis exercise was conducted
- Item – The scenario, product, or process involved in the simulation
- Corrections to the Crisis Management Plan – Updates or improvements identified during the exercise
- Completed By – The individual responsible for conducting or documenting the challenge
- Comments – Observations, outcomes, and lessons learned
This structured overview ensures mock crisis exercises lead to actionable improvements and stronger crisis response preparedness.
Why it matters
It strengthens crisis readiness by identifying weaknesses in the response plan and ensuring corrective improvements are made before a real incident occurs.
Step-by-step actions
1 — Open the Management Section
From the left-side dashboard menu, click on the Management section icon to access all management-related tools and records.

2 — Select “Mock Crisis Challenge”
Within the Mock Crisis Challenge module, select Mock Crisis Challenge to view the list of existing mock crisis records.
This opens the page where all mock crisis challenges are displayed.

3 — Create a New Mock Crisis Challenge
To create a new mock crisis challenge, click the purple “Create Mock Crisis Challenge” button located at the top left of the page.
A form will appear where you can:
- Select the location
- Specify the item
- Choose the status
- Document corrective actions
- Enter corrections to the crisis management plan
- (Optional) Add comments for additional context or observations
Once completed, click Submit — the mock crisis challenge is now saved in the system.


4 — Modify an Existing Mock Crisis Challenge
To update an existing record, locate it in the list and click the green pen icon beside its name.
This allows you to revise the location, item, status, corrective actions, crisis plan corrections, or optional comments.

5 — Delete an Existing Mock Crisis Challenge
To delete a mock crisis challenge, locate it in the list and click the red trash icon beside its name.
This permanently removes the record from the system.
